Maruti Suzuki launches new SUV

New Delhi: Maruti Suzuki on Monday launched its new compact SUV Grand Vitara.

Priced between Rs 10.45 lakh and Rs 17.05 lakh, the four-wheeler will be available in 10 variants, with three dual-tone and six monotone colour options, including the iconic NEXA Blue, a statement from the company said.

Hisashi Takeuchi, Managing Director and CEO, Maruti Suzuki India Ltd, said: “Designed to rule every road, the Grand Vitara has received an overwhelming response from customers with over 57,000 bookings and it has been widely appreciated by critics as well.

“The Grand Vitara has appealed to a wide range of customers with multiple offerings. The Grand Vitara Intelligent Electric Hybrid boasts segment-leading fuel-efficiency and a pure EV driving mode. The All-Wheel Drive (AWD) Grand Vitara featuring Suzuki’s legendary Allgrip select technology will appeal to hardcore SUV aficionados.’
